Overview

This file defines a static map layout used for generating an "Insanity" theme arena (e.g., during the Max Fight or similar events). It is a Tiled-compatible data structure describing the visual and spatial configuration of a 16x16 tile map. The layout includes a background tile layer (BG_TILES) that places visual elements (tile ID 8 in two rows) and an object layer (FG_OBJECTS) containing 16 insanityrock placement markers and one wormhole object at the center. This file does not represent an ECS component but rather a map-level static layout definition consumed by the world generation system to instantiate scenery and wormhole entries in the game world.

Usage example

This file is a static data definition loaded by the world generation engine and not directly used in component scripts. It is included in the static layout registry via map/static_layouts/insanity_wormhole_1.lua and referenced in relevant tasksets or task files (e.g., during event-based world generation). No direct Lua instantiation is required by modders.

Properties

The file exports a top-level Lua table with fixed structure defined by Tiled map format. No custom component constructor or class logic exists.

PropertyTypeDefault ValueDescription
versionstring"1.1"Tiled version compatibility tag.
luaversionstring"5.1"Lua version used for embedded scripts (none present).
orientationstring"orthogonal"Map rendering orientation.
widthnumber16Map width in tiles.
heightnumber16Map height in tiles.
tilewidthnumber16Width of each tile in pixels.
tileheightnumber16Height of each tile in pixels.
propertiestable{ ["wormhole"] = "{foo=\"bar\"}" }Custom properties attached to the map; includes "wormhole" key indicating this layout contains a wormhole entry.
tilesetstable(see source)Tileset definitions used for tile layers.
layerstable(see source)Layer data including background tiles (tilelayer) and foreground objects (objectgroup).
